首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在xsd中只在一个字段中验证最大长度

在XSD中,可以使用<xs:maxLength>元素来验证一个字段的最大长度。<xs:maxLength>元素是XSD中的一个内置限制,用于指定一个字符串字段的最大字符数。

以下是一个示例XSD代码,演示如何在一个字段中验证最大长度为10个字符:

代码语言:txt
复制
<xs:schema xmlns:xs="http://www.w3.org/2001/XMLSchema">
  <xs:element name="example">
    <xs:complexType>
      <xs:sequence>
        <xs:element name="field">
          <xs:simpleType>
            <xs:restriction base="xs:string">
              <xs:maxLength value="10"/>
            </xs:restriction>
          </xs:simpleType>
        </xs:element>
      </xs:sequence>
    </xs:complexType>
  </xs:element>
</xs:schema>

在上述示例中,<xs:maxLength>元素被用于限制<field>元素的最大长度为10个字符。如果超过了这个限制,将会触发验证错误。

这种验证最大长度的方法适用于任何包含字符串字段的XML文档。它可以用于验证各种类型的数据,例如名称、描述、地址等。

腾讯云相关产品和产品介绍链接地址:

请注意,以上链接仅供参考,具体产品选择应根据实际需求和情况进行评估。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的合辑

领券